Output 708b7acd660a37be2077173c2edb223f14c36fe201c02bc8f599765f5effa028:108

value
93966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db4cf21bae463ab4593c5e58bd1bd3214462a9a OP_EQUAL
address
37KHk5joG9RHiFJi22ecdFp6dZhfjQFs5t
transaction
708b7acd660a37be2077173c2edb223f14c36fe201c02bc8f599765f5effa028
spent
true